FOOTBALLERS from Stevenage Boro were on their marks alongside supporters on Sunday morning when they took part in a charity fun run.
The players and other club officials joined fans of all ages for the event to raise money for Leukaemia Care wearing Santa outfits.
The starting point was Boro's Broadhall Way ground and followed a short course around Fairlands Valley Park.
First to cross the finishing line was Boro defender Hasim Deen followed by Dale Binns with the club's chief executive Bob Makin in a respectable midfield finish.
